520 | _aThe presented thesis aimed at the discovery of the therapeutic agents derived from Justicia spicigera (Family: Acanthaceae) which can be useful in drug industry. The total saponin content gave concentration of 0.2083582 mg/ g of the dried powder as standard diosgenin. GLC analysis of the cold & hot mucilage hydrolyzate revealed the presence of seven free sugars including , Arabinose, ribose, rhamnose,sorbitol, galactose and glucose. The total phenolic content (TPC) was determined in all the extracts and fractions as gallic acid equivalents (GAE) to give results of 9.13±0.32, 13.63±0.51, 42.94±0.62, 8.76±0.73, 42.39±0.14 expressed as mg/g for petroleum ether fraction, chloroformic fraction, ethyl acetate fraction, butanol fraction, and water extract respectively. Analysis of total amino acids content yielded 0.3% ,16 amino acids were identified, the main of which are, Glutamic acid(40.87 %) , Aspartic acid( 8.35 %), Arginine (7.53 %), phenylalanine (6.23 %), leucine (5.85 % ). The yield of the volatiles is 0.02%. 1-Octen-3-ol, Hexenal 2E , Decenal 2E, are the major constituents of the volatile content of the plant of percentages (62.52%, 10.66%, 9.29%), respectively. GC/MS analysis of the unsaponifiable matters revealed the identification of sixteen compounds, amounting 94.67 %. Identified saponifiable matters represented 53.95 %. Six main compounds assigned as P1-P6 were isolated from the pet ether fraction and turned out to be hentriacontane, tritriacontane, octacosanol, triacontanol, phytol & Ý-sitosterol. The use of HPLC led to the identification of delphinidin chloride in anthocyanin extract and ethyl acetate fraction which recorded a concentration of 12.075 and 2.149 mg/100g, respectively | ||
